Ethereum (ETH) Shows Stronger Short-Term Momentum Than Bitcoin (BTC)... 30-Day Gain of 34.79%

Ethereum (ETH) is showing stronger price momentum than Bitcoin (BTC) on a daily chart basis. While both assets maintain an uptrend in their medium-term structures, Ethereum is leading in short-term price strength.

■ Ethereum Leads in Daily, Weekly, and Monthly Returns

As of the 12th, Ethereum was recorded at $2,533.57. Its daily change was up approximately 0.70%, higher than Bitcoin's 0.12% rise. Over the past 7 days, Ethereum gained 3.16% while Bitcoin fell 2.94%. The 30-day gains were 34.79% for Ethereum and 21.80% for Bitcoin, showing Ethereum's edge in medium-term performance as well.

■ Ethereum Also Stronger in RSI and Price Position... Superior Short-Term Buying Pressure

In terms of price position, Bitcoin is at $77,315.99, about 4.03% below its recent 7-day high. Its RSI(6) stands at 42.19, near the lower end of the neutral zone. Meanwhile, Ethereum is about 4.97% below its recent 7-day high but has rebounded about 5.31% from its recent low. Its RSI(6) is 64.93, higher than Bitcoin's, indicating relatively stronger short-term buying pressure.

■ Trend Structure: MA and SuperTrend Both Maintain Uptrend

Both assets remain in an uptrend structurally. Bitcoin and Ethereum are both trading above MA7, MA25, and MA99, and SuperTrend remains in an upward direction. In terms of the medium-term moving average structure, the uptrend has not yet been broken.

■ Short-Term Caution: MACD Dead Cross Signals Remain

However, there are cautionary signals in short-term momentum indicators. Bitcoin's MACD showed a dead cross 8 days ago, and Ethereum's 11 days ago. Even if the uptrend continues, it is difficult to rule out a pattern of alternating rebounds and corrections in the short term.

■ Volume and Large-Order Fund Flows Favor Bitcoin

Volume requires careful interpretation as the daily candle has not yet closed. Current ongoing volume is at about 0.30 times the recent 7-day average for Bitcoin and about 0.25 times for Ethereum. Net inflow rate based on large orders was 4.27% for Bitcoin and 2.72% for Ethereum, with Bitcoin higher. While Ethereum leads in price movement and RSI, Bitcoin holds the advantage in the ratio of large-order fund inflows.

In the short-term market, it can be seen that Ethereum is leading price momentum while Bitcoin shows relative strength in fund inflow indicators.

■ Differences in Asset Characteristics... Ethereum's Elasticity Grows When Risk Appetite Spreads

The differing characteristics of the two assets may also influence price reactions. Bitcoin has a strong character as a benchmark asset reflecting overall risk appetite in the virtual asset market, while Ethereum has greater exposure to on-chain ecosystem activities such as smart contracts, DeFi, and tokenization. Accordingly, Ethereum's price elasticity may grow larger in periods when market risk appetite spreads beyond Bitcoin to altcoins and the on-chain ecosystem. Conversely, if risk aversion intensifies, the possibility that Ethereum's volatility will exceed Bitcoin's must also be considered.

■ Key Points to Watch Going Forward

Looking at the current trend alone, Ethereum appears stronger than Bitcoin in recent 7-day and 30-day returns as well as RSI. However, with MACD bearish signals remaining for both assets, the continuation of the trend should be confirmed alongside trading volume and whether recent highs are retested and broken.
